There are a few different tools you can use to cut off a lock. Bolt cutters are the most common. Simply clip off the lock's shackle to remove it. You could also use an angle grinder and cut through the shackle, but you'll need to secure it with vice grips and wear face protection to protect against flying sparks.Will a hacksaw cut through a padlock?

What size of bolt cutters should you use to cut a padlock? A set of 24-inch bolt cutters can cut metal up to 7/16-inch in diameter, which will cut the bolts on most standard padlocks. For higher-quality padlocks that use a harder metal, use a 36-inch bolt cutter.Can padlocks be cut by bolt cutters?
